Course Description
In this video, Dr. Mark Fleming discusses a submitted case where the doctor got a strange proposal. The thread can be viewed here: https://www.cerecdoctors.com/discussion-boards/view/id/63506.

Level ICA: CEREC and Cone Beam– Integration in Surgical Implant Dentistry for Guided Surgery
This course will give you the experience to utilize the Sirona Cone Beam CT (Galileos or XG3D) for surgical planning of implants and may help you to understand the fundamentals of guided implant surgery. Intended for clinicians who are interested in, new to, or moderately experienced with implant therapy.
